Understanding the Psychological Impact of Relaxing Games on Stress Reduction
Relaxing games tap into fundamental psychological processes by offering players a controlled environment that induces calmness and mental reprieve. These games often utilize minimalist design, soothing soundscapes, and engaging but non-competitive mechanics that encourage a flow state – a psychological condition characterized by full immersion and diminished self-awareness. Achieving flow is linked to reduced cortisol levels, the hormone associated with stress, creating a physiological pathway for relaxation. Moreover, the repetitive and predictable nature of relaxing games can facilitate mindfulness, allowing individuals to redirect negative thought patterns and promote emotional regulation.
Key psychological mechanisms engaged include:
- Distraction: Redirects focus from stressors, reducing cognitive load.
- Autonomy: Provides a sense of control, enhancing intrinsic motivation.
- Achievement without pressure: Enables accomplishment that boosts self-efficacy without inducing anxiety.
Psychological Element | Impact on Stress |
---|---|
Flow State Induction | Enhances focus, reduces anxiety |
Mindfulness Facilitation | Promotes emotional regulation |
Autonomous Player Experience | Fosters agency, reducing helplessness |
Evaluating Game Mechanics That Enhance Calmness and Mindfulness
Incorporating specific game mechanics can significantly influence a player’s state of calmness and mindfulness. Among these, slow-paced progression stands out, allowing users to immerse themselves without pressure or urgency. Games that utilize gentle feedback loops, such as subtle audio cues and smooth visual transitions, foster an environment conducive to relaxation. This is complemented by mechanics encouraging exploration without penalty, where players engage in discovery at their own rhythm, enhancing focus and reducing anxiety.
Additionally, the use of minimalistic interfaces and repetitive, rhythmic tasks has been shown to promote meditative states. The table below outlines several key mechanics often employed in relaxing games and their direct impact on mindfulness:
Game Mechanic | Mindfulness Effect | Stress Relief Benefit |
---|---|---|
Slow-paced progression | Enhances presence and patience | Reduces cortisol levels |
Repetitive, rhythmic tasks | Encourages focus and flow | Diminishes racing thoughts |
Exploration without penalty | Fosters curiosity-driven engagement | Alleviates performance anxiety |
Minimalistic interface | Limits distractions | Improves cognitive clarity |
Understanding and integrating these mechanics can empower developers to create experiences that not only entertain but also serve as effective tools in stress reduction and mindfulness training. The intentional design of such features aligns gameplay with psychological benefits, opening new pathways for interactive mental wellness.
Comparative Analysis of Popular Relaxing Games and Their Therapeutic Benefits
When examining popular relaxing games through the lens of therapeutic benefits, it becomes clear that their design elements cater to various stress relief mechanisms. Titles such as Stardew Valley and Animal Crossing leverage slow-paced gameplay and open-ended objectives, which promote mindfulness and reduce anxiety by encouraging players to focus on simple, repetitive tasks. Conversely, games like Journey and Flower utilize immersive audiovisual experiences that evoke emotional calm and foster a meditative state. The diversity in gameplay mechanics across these titles allows players to choose experiences tailored to their individual coping preferences, whether they seek distraction, emotional engagement, or sensory relaxation.
Comparing the therapeutic effectiveness of these games reveals key factors that enhance their stress-relief potential:
- Interactivity: Low-pressure interaction reduces cognitive load and promotes relaxation.
- Visual and auditory design: Soothing graphics and soundtracks stimulate positive emotional responses.
- Progression systems: Gentle, non-competitive progression encourages sustained engagement without frustration.
- Social elements: Optional multiplayer modes offer community support and connection, strengthening emotional well-being.
Game | Core Relaxation Mechanism | Therapeutic Benefit |
---|---|---|
Stardew Valley | Farming & Routine Tasks | Mindfulness & Reduced Anxiety |
Animal Crossing | Exploration & Social Interaction | Emotional Connection & Stress Reduction |
Journey | Immersive Storytelling & Visuals | Meditative Calm & Emotional Release |
Flower | Flowing, Guided Movement | Sensory Relaxation & Mindfulness |
Strategic Recommendations for Integrating Relaxing Games into Stress Management Practices
To maximize the benefits of relaxing games within stress management frameworks, it is essential to align game selection with individual therapeutic goals and user preferences. Incorporating these games as complementary tools alongside traditional stress relief methods – such as mindfulness, cognitive behavioral techniques, or physical exercise – ensures a holistic approach. Prioritizing personalization in game choice enhances engagement, making stress relief not only effective but also sustainable over time.
Integration strategies should also emphasize practical deployment settings. For example, workplace wellness programs can offer short, structured gaming breaks using titles that promote calming visuals and gentle interactions. Meanwhile, clinical environments might benefit from curated game libraries explicitly designed to target anxiety symptoms. Below is a concise framework for implementation phases, illustrating optimal game characteristics corresponding to specific stress management goals:
Implementation Phase | Game Characteristics | Stress Management Goal |
---|---|---|
Initial Engagement | Simple mechanics, soothing audio | Quick relaxation, easing into calm state |
Focused Intervention | Mindfulness prompts, slow-paced tasks | Enhancing concentration, interrupting stress cycles |
Long-Term Use | Progress tracking, adaptive difficulty | Building resilience, sustaining relaxation habits |
- Regularity and Routine: Establish gaming moments as fixed parts of daily relaxation.
- Feedback Mechanisms: Use monitoring tools to adjust game difficulty or duration based on stress level.
- Environment Optimization: Encourage use in quiet, comfortable locations to amplify calming effects.
